I see in many classifieds that the Datejust ref. 116200/116234 is reported to be sized 37 mm instead of 36 declared by Rolex.
I know that the 16200 is 35 mm instead of the declared 36 (http://clockmaker.com.au/rolex_case_size.html) So what's the exact case diameter of the 116200? |

I believe the 36mm DJ actually measures 35mm, but for reference is always referred to as 36mm. I don't think the standard DJ has changed dimensions. The AK and Date are called 34mm (don't know how big actually), but the difference next to a DJ is pretty clear. I doubt that it is 1mm.
